WoRMS taxon details
Anoplodactylus petiolatus (Kroyer, 1844) AphiaID: 134723
| Status | | accepted |
Record status | | Checked by Taxonomic Editor |
| Rank | | Species |
| Parent | | Anoplodactylus Wilson, 1878 |
Synonymised taxa | |
Anoplodactylus guyanensis Child, 1977
Anoplodactylus hedgpethi Bacescu, 1959
Anoplodactylus longicollis (Dohrn, 1881)
Anoplodactylus pygmaeus (Hoek, 1881) non-(Hodge, 1864)
Pallene attenuata Hodge, 1864
Phoxichilidium attenuatus (Hodge, 1863)
Phoxichilidium longicolle Dohrn, 1881
